Jannis Kounellis--Artist

Jannis Kounellis was born in Piraeus in Greece and has lived and worked in Rome since 1956. He was a seminal contributor to the radically and internationally influential Arte Povera group. Often epic in scale, Kounellis’s work possesses a grandeur that reflects his frequent choice of themes and ideas from the past and particularly from Ancient Greece.

During the 1960s Kounellis abandoned traditional painting in favour of a host of found and everyday materials with which he created sculptures and installations using materials such as sacking, beans, cotton, metal and wool. This exhibition of sculptures at Tramway draws together some of the most significant works from the ARTIST ROOMS collection and new work which responds to the unique context of Tramway’s redoubtable main gallery.
